OSCEOLA COUNTY, Fla. – Osceola County deputies are searching for a missing 87-year-old man who was last seen driving near Kissimmee, according to the sheriff’s office.

Fred M. Bennett has been missing since Friday and was last seen driving a 2002 Toyota Camry with Florida tag JYSR20 in the vicinity of Idora Boulevard, traveling in an unknown direction, the sheriff’s office said on social media.

Bennett is 5 feet, 6 inches tall and 135 pounds with white hair and brown eyes, according to the post.

He was last seen wearing a blue polo shirt, black or navy pants, and brown shoes, the post states.

Anyone who sees Bennett or has knowledge of his whereabouts is urged to contact the sheriff’s office by calling 407-348-2222.
